India on Friday voiced concern over the growing try in direction of eradicating ladies from public life in Afghanistan, calling for guaranteeing safety of rights of girls and ladies and that long-fought beneficial properties of the final 20 years should not reversed.

“As a contiguous neighbour and long-standing partner of Afghanistan, India has direct stakes in ensuring the return of peace and stability to the country,” Ambassador Puneet Agrawal, Deputy Permanent Representative of India, Permanent Mission of India in Geneva.

Speaking on the pressing debate on “the situation of human rights of women and girls in Afghanistan” on the fiftieth Session of the Human Rights Council, he stated given India’s sturdy historic and civilisational linkages to the Afghan individuals, “we are deeply concerned about the recent developments in Afghanistan, which directly impact the well-being of women and girls of Afghanistan. There has been an increasing attempt towards removing women from public life in Afghanistan”.

“We join others in calling for ensuring the protection of rights of women and girls, including their right to education, and to ensure that the long-fought gains of the last two decades are not reversed,” Agrawal stated.

The Taliban returned to energy in Afghanistan in mid-August 2021 after seizing the capital Kabul, bringing to a swift finish nearly 20 years of a US-led coalition’s presence within the war-torn nation. After taking energy, the hardline Islamist group has been issuing new legal guidelines, saying that ladies ought to solely go away their houses in instances of necessity after which, with their faces lined in public.

Agrawal additionally expressed India’s deepest condolences to the victims and their households, and to these impacted by the devastating earthquake in Afghanistan. He stated India shares the grief of the individuals of Afghanistan and “as a true friend of Afghanistan and first responder”, has dispatched 27 tonnes of emergency aid help in two flights for the individuals of Afghanistan.

Noting that the fundamental rights of civilians, youngsters, women and girls together with freedom of speech and opinion, entry to schooling and medical care have been drastically hampered as a result of ongoing state of affairs, Agrawal known as upon all of the events involved to permit unhindered entry to worldwide help for all those that are within the want of it.

“In order to closely monitor and coordinate the efforts of various stakeholders for the effective delivery of humanitarian assistance and in continuation of our engagement with the Afghan people, an Indian technical team has been deployed in our Embassy there,” he stated.

He recalled the UN Security Council’s Resolution on Afghanistan and stated that expectations of the worldwide group on the way in which ahead in Afghanistan have been clearly outlined within the Security Council’s Resolution 2593, which underlines that the territory of Afghanistan isn’t used to launch terrorist assaults towards different nations; formation of a really inclusive and consultant authorities; combating terrorism and drug trafficking; and preserving the rights of girls, youngsters and minorities.

“We join others in their call for ensuring the protection of rights of women and girls in Afghanistan,” Agrawal stated, including that India additionally urges the United Nations Assistance Mission in Afghanistan to make all efforts to make sure that the rights of girls, youngsters and minorities are revered and preserved.
